What are the steps to installing a roof in California?

Roof installation in California commences with a comprehensive site assessment and material selection, followed by the removal of existing roofing layers down to the deck. The process then involves inspecting and repairing the roof deck, applying a protective underlayment such as synthetic felt or modified bitumen, and meticulously installing the chosen roofing material, be it asphalt shingles, metal panels, or tile, ensuring proper flashing and ventilation.

What is the cheapest type of roof to install in California?

While asphalt shingles, particularly 3-tab architectural shingles, are often considered the most economical initial roofing material in California, their long-term cost-effectiveness can be influenced by climate and maintenance. Factors such as material quality, underlayment choice, and installation expertise significantly impact the overall investment and lifespan, even for the least expensive options.
